Description
Summary:Paratuberculosis is a chronic infectious disease caused by Mycobacterium avium ssp. paratuberculosis (MAP). This study aimed at determining the presence of antibodies against MAP, and the association between the serological status of MAP and individual factors in goats and sheep in a flock in Antioquia, Colombia. We studied fifty-three goats and 6 sheep over two years old, and took blood samples to obtain serum and information on individual factors. The presence of antibodies against MAP was determined by ELISA, whereas the information was descriptively analyzed. ELISA did not detect any positive or suspect animal among the 59 tested animals, so an association between serological status to MAP and individual factors could not be established. This is the first and the fourth study reporting the search for antibodies against MAP in a goat and in a sheep population in Colombia, respectively. Several factors may explain the serological status of the sampled animals. It is necessary to continue with similar studies in other flocks of the region and the country to determine the current MAP infection status in small ruminants in Colombia.
